  1. 1 Whether the defendant breached the sale agreement of a brand-new tipper truck entered into between the plaintiff and defendant
  2. 2 What reliefs are parties entitled to

Ratio Decidendi

Plaintiff failed to pay the full purchase price, voluntarily entered into termination agreement, and thus breached the contract; defendant did not breach the sale agreement.

Court Disposition

Suit dismissed with costs

Orders

  • Suit dismissed for want of merits
  • Plaintiff to pay costs
